2 clematis or just different size flowers?!

loliloli Posts: 61
I moved into my house and after a year this clematis popped up and had been growing more vigorously each year. There’s 2 different flowers growing on it but I cannot figure if it is 2 different clematis or if it is just different flowers on the one. As there are bigger purple flowers on the top and then smaller pink tipped flowers below. Looking at the roots I can’t see separate plants but lots of stems come from the same area.

  • LynLyn Posts: 22,886
    Some Clematis have a 2 season flowering time, as it was a cold Spring it may have delayed the Spring blooming, then with the hot weather the second flush has come early, thus two different flowers together. 
    From the picture I can’t see any difference on yours.
